A game in which each player has a finite number of moves and a finite number of choices at each move.

The first mid-arc point is the triangle center with triangle center function alpha_(177)=[cos(1/2B)+cos(1/2C)]sec(1/2A). It is Kimberling center X_(177).

A catastrophe which can occur for one control factor and one behavior axis. It is the universal unfolding of the singularity f(x)=x^3 and has the equation F(x,u)=x^3+ux.

A semigroup with a noncommutative product in which no product can ever be expressed more simply in terms of other elements.
